On Thursday, July 10 and Friday, July 11, Rome will host the Ukraine Recovery Conference 2025. Opening the work on the first day will be Prime Minister Giorgia Meloni. More than 90 countries and 80 heads of state and government are expected at the EUR space’s “Nuvola”, including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ky, European Commission President Ursula von der Leyen, German Chancellor Friedrich Merz, and Polish Prime Minister Donald Tusk. Meloni and Merz will connect via video conference to the summit of the “Coalition of the Willing”, convened by Emmanuel Macron and Keir Starmer at Northwood Air Base, just outside London. Both the French President and the UK Prime Minister will therefore not be present at the Rome conference. Instead, representatives from 2,000 companies will be present. The Volunteers were formed in February with the goal of structuring a force of peacekeepers in Ukraine after the ceasefire. Rome's is the fourth conference on Ukraine's recovery, following events in Lugano (2022), London (2023) and Berlin (2024).
